$200,000 Funding Available for Development of Innovative Conservation Technologies in New Hampshire (10)
WASHINGTON, May 9 -- The U.S. Department of Agriculture's Natural Resources Conservation Service announced that it expects to award up to five grants for the development and adoption of innovative conservation approaches and technologies in New Hampshire. The estimated total program funding available was cited as $200,000. The categories of funding activity are a) agriculture, b) environment and c) natural resources. $3 Million Funding Available for Urban Agriculture & Innovation Production Program (10)
WASHINGTON, May 7 -- The U.S. Department of Agriculture's Natural Resources Conservation Service announced that it expects to award grants for the urban agriculture and innovation production program. The estimated total program funding available was cited as $3 million with a ceiling of $500,000. The categories of funding activity is a) agriculture, b) environment and c) natural resources. $5 Million Funding Available for Wetland Mitigation Banking Program (10)
WASHINGTON, May 6 -- The U.S. Department of Agriculture's Natural Resources Conservation Service announced that it expects to award up to eight grants for the wetland mitigation banking program. The estimated total program funding available was cited as $5 million with a ceiling of $1 million. The categories of funding activity are a) agriculture, b) environment and c) natural resources. $5.2 Million Funding Available for Tribal Wildlife Program (10)
WASHINGTON, May 6 -- The U.S. Department of the Interior's U.S. Fish and Wildlife Service announced that it expects to award up to 25 grants for the tribal wildlife program. The estimated total program funding available was cited as $5,209,000 with a ceiling of $200,000. The categories of funding activity are a) environment and b) natural resources.
